  1. Determine your skin tone

This is usually the first step when it comes to choosing the right colour for you. The five main types of skin complexions are; fair, light, medium, tan and deep. Those with fair and light skin tones should look for peach, nude, coral and dusty red lipstick shades. Then those with medium skin tone should go for rose, mauve, berry and cherry red lipstick shades. The tan complexion usually goes well with bright red, deep pink and coral lip shades whereas the deep complexion is perfect for the brown, plum wine, caramel and any other purple hues.

  1. Determine your undertone

Knowledge of your skin undertone will also help in picking the right lipstick shade. The three main undertones are cool, warm and neutral.

Cool undertone:

Usually have pink, red or bluish hue to their skin.

Fair or light skin – rosy and nude shades

Medium skin – pink or cranberry shades

Tan or deep skin – wine or rube shades

Warm undertone:

Usually have yellow, golden or olive hue to their skin.

Fair or light skin – peachy and pale pink shades

Medium, tan or deep skin – copper or bronze shades

Neutral:

Usually have a mix of yellow and pink in the base of their skin.

Goes well with both cool and warm undertones.

A rule of thumb is to correspond your skin tone with the lipstick shade. For example, if you’re lighter then go for paler shades but if you’re deeper go for richer shades.

  1. Determine the shape and size of your lips

The shape and size of your lips also play a huge role in determining the perfect lipstick for you.

Top heavy lips:

  • Apply a bright lipstick on the bottom lip and a slightly darker shade on the upper lip.

Bottom heavy lips:

  • Apply any colour that suits your undertone then add a little bit of nude at the center of the upper lip.

Asymmetrical lips:

  • Outline your lips first with a lip pencil in the shade similar to the lipstick you’re about to apply.

Thin lips:

  • Avoid dark and flashy colours as they will make your lips look even thinner. Go for light creamy lipsticks and lip glosses instead.

Plump lips:

  • Go for darker shades and avoid hues that are too light or glossy or even with glittery texture.
